1 Justin Gaitlin

Are we looking at Usain Bolt’s replacement? Gaitlin just won the 100M World Championship race. This was supposed to be Bolt’s final individual race and fans came in their numbers to watch him go out unbeaten, but alas, the gold was stolen by another.

Although Gaitlin’s career has been beset by doping allegations, this act had the world in awe.
